The polynomial f(x) is define by f(x) = 3x^3 + 2x^2 - 8x + 4. Evaluate f(2).

f(x) = 3x^3 + 2x^2 - 8x + 4

f(2) = 3(2)^3 + 2(2)^2 - 8(2) + 4

f(2) = 3(8) + 2(4) - 8(2) + 4

f(2) = 24 + 8 - 16 +4

f(2) = 20

Integrate x*sin(x) with respect to x.

We integrate by parts: u=x   u'=1;  v'=sin(x)  v=-cos(x) integral(xsin(x)dx) = -xcos(x) + integral(cos(x)dx) = -x*cos(x) + sin(x) + C where C is a constant.
